Giants Rookie T.J. Moore Carted Off With Right-Leg Injury After Pick-Six in Preseason Finale

The undrafted cornerback faces testing as Tuesday's 53-man cuts near.

Overview

  • Moore was injured on special-teams coverage in the fourth quarter shortly after a 44-yard interception return for a touchdown.
  • Medical staff immobilized his right leg as teammates, including quarterbacks Russell Wilson, Jameis Winston, and Jaxson Dart, helped him onto the cart.
  • He gave a thumbs-up to the crowd while being taken to the locker room, and head coach Brian Daboll said afterward the situation "wasn't good."
  • The Giants beat the Patriots 42-10 at MetLife Stadium to close the preseason 3-0, with roster decisions due Aug. 26.
  • An undrafted rookie out of Mercer who earned a contract after rookie minicamp, Moore had been pushing for a spot on the 53-man roster.
